Faithless - Insomnia (Martin Volt, Le Que & Sebastien Lintz Remix)

'Insomnia' is a song recorded by British dance group Faithless, consisting of Maxi Jazz, Sister Bliss and Rollo. Released as the band's second single, it became one of their most successful. It was released in 1995 and became a hit in Dance Charts while peaking at #27 in the UK in 1995 and #3 in 1996 . The song also reached #48 in the UK chart as a re-entry in 2005 showing the song's longevity. The album version is nearly nine minutes long and contains some lyrics not able to be broadcast on the radio edit due to their explicit content.

Martin Volt is a Dutch house DJ/producer whose tracks are already supported by many DJs across the globe. The future is looking bright for Martin Volt, with a discography quickly expanding, a track signed on Laidback Luke's MixMash Records and lots of tracks on the pipeline, you can't get around him soon. Sebastien Lintz is fast becoming known and respected in the world of house music. Not just among the many top DJs who are supporting him, but among a wide audience. Still only young, Sebastien has a string of successes, and many more in the pipeline. With support from names like Laidback Luke, Chuckie, Hardwell and Bingo Players, the young Dutch DJ and producer, Le Que, is on his way to become a high roller in the dance-scene. Given the rate of growth, it will soon be difficult to avoid his sound. These three guys made a massive rework of 'Insomnia' with big kickdrums and slamming piano chords. It's available for free.
